/// Iterator which returns ready results from a `Vec<JobResult<O>>.
///
/// This Iterator waits for each `JobResult<O>` with a timeout and yields a result once it finds one finished `JobResult<O>`.
///
/// # Example
/// ```ignore
/// // Started Tasks which are pending
/// let pending_tasks = vec![...];
///
/// for task in pending_tasks {
/// // blocks and waits for the first `JobResult<_>` even though the next ones in the `Vec<_>` could be finished and processed already.
/// let result = task.wait();
/// // ...
/// }
///
/// // With the Iterator
///
/// for value in PendingTaskIterator(pending_tasks) {
/// // You can immidiatelly start processing the first finished result
/// // ...
/// }
/// ```
pub struct PendingTaskIterator<O>(pub Vec<JobResult<O>>);
impl<O: for<'a> Deserialize<'a>> Iterator for PendingTaskIterator<O> {
type Item = O;
fn next(&mut self) -> Option<Self::Item> {
if self.0.is_empty() {
return None;
}
loop {
for (i, task) in self.0.iter().enumerate() {
if let Some(res) = task.wait_timeout() {
self.0.remove(i);
return Some(res);
}
}
}
}
}
